Address 73.66953574 DOGE

DMtCjVRQyttH2psH7RtcvyQfZ9ma9eKMyH

Confirmed

Total Received73.66953574 DOGE
Total Sent0 DOGE
Final Balance73.66953574 DOGE
No. Transactions1

Transactions